Combinatorial Functional Equations : : Basic Theory / / Yanpei Liu.
This two-volume set presents combinatorial functional equations using an algebraic approach, and illustrates their applications in combinatorial maps, graphs, networks, etc. The first volume mainly presents basic concepts and the theoretical background.
